🦁 Join the Zoo Crew at Whipsnade Zoo! 🦒Looking for the perfect family day out this summer? Until 2nd September, little adventurers can become part of the Zoo Crew, stepping into the shoes of a: 🦓 Zookeeper🥕 Animal Nutritionist🌍 Field Conservationist🔬 ScientistThe best part? All of the Zoo Crew activities are included with your zoo admission! While you're there, don't miss: 🐆 The seven adorable cheetah cubs at Cheetah Rock 🐘 The gorgeous baby Asian elephant 🦌 The beautiful Mountain Bongo calf 🦏 Plus over 10,000 animals across the UK's largest zoo!📍 Whipsnade Zoo, Whipsnade, Dunstable, LU6 2LF🎟️ Tickets from £21.35 for children and £30.50 for adults when booked online in advance. Under 3s go FREE, and family tickets can save up to £35. Book before 2nd September and you'll also receive a FREE return visit to either Whipsnade Zoo or London Zoo (T&Cs apply).📱 Download the free Whipsnade Zoo app before you visit for daily talk times, feeding schedules and an interactive map to help you explore the zoo.Have you visited Whipsnade Zoo this summer? Great Ormond Street Hospital – Day 2 (Evening Update) 💙Unfortunately, the evening took an unexpected turn.Around 7pm, Florence said she was feeling sick, and shortly afterwards she started coughing and was sick on and off for around an hour and a half. It was heartbreaking to see her feeling so poorly after such a positive day.The team acted incredibly quickly. Blood tests showed that Florence's potassium levels were low, so they repeated them to double-check. When they came back low again, she had an ECG to make sure everything with her heart was okay. Thankfully, everything looked normal, which was a huge relief.Because of her low potassium, Florence needed another cannula so she could have fluids with potassium running through them. She now has two cannulas, and despite everything, she was so incredibly brave while having more blood taken and another cannula inserted. I'm endlessly proud of her. 💜As she'd been feeling so sick, her medication was paused for a little while to give her body a chance to settle. The doctors also requested a chest X-ray to make sure everything was okay. The portable X-ray machine came straight into her room, which Florence thought was very impressive!She's also been struggling with a headache, so she's had pain relief throughout the evening to try and keep her comfortable.Because of her low potassium levels, Florence is now also having continuous ECG monitoring so the team can keep a close eye on her heart while the potassium replacement is running. It's reassuring to know she's being monitored so closely.It's now 11pm, and we're snuggled up watching the Trolls movie together while we wait for everything to settle. There are still a few things the team are keeping a close eye on tonight, but thankfully Florence is slowly starting to drift off to sleep. I'm really hoping she manages to get some good rest tonight and wakes up feeling much brighter tomorrow.The staff here continue to be absolutely amazing, and we're so grateful for the care they're giving Florence. Watching your child push themselves outside their comfort zone is one of the best feelings. 💚🌳 @willen_lakeThe Treetop Extreme Explorer course at Willen Lake was such a brilliant adventure for Florence. There were wobbly bridges to cross, climbing challenges to tackle and, of course, plenty of zip wires to finish each section with a huge smile!It wasn't about racing to the end it was about building confidence, trying something new and proving to herself that she could do it. Seeing her determination grow with every obstacle made us so proud.Set high amongst the trees, the Explorer course is the perfect mix of fun, adventure and confidence-building, with just enough challenge to make every achievement feel even more rewarding. It's an experience that leaves children beaming from ear to ear and already asking when they can do it again!📍 Willen Lake Adventure Golf, Willen Lake, Milton Keynes MK15 0DS💰 Treetop Explorer Prices🌳 Child: £14🌳 Adult: £22✨ Includes the exciting Treetop Drop, and groups of 6+ receive 10% off! by @growingwith.theflo
